Jenofa Berhokoirigoin and the On.eus portal have received the main Rikardo Arregi awards
The Bastero Cultural Center in Andoain hosted this Wednesday's Rikardo Arregi Awards , which recognize the best works in journalism and communication in Basque. The Journalism Award has been awarded to journalist Jenofa Berhokoirigoin ofArgiaand the KCommunication Award hasbeen awarded to the On.eus portal.
The highest award in journalism has been awarded to journalist Jenofa Berhokoirigoin of Argia, a profession that has been going on for centuries trying to adapt to the new times for the report. The journalist has been grateful for rewarding her efforts to do a different journalism from the Euskera and the Euskera. She has also dedicated the award to the farmers, "to all those who make the choice of popular cultivation, who look the other way, but society needs you, and we will continue to tell you, as we say, that we are not neutral."
For its part, the Communication Award has been awarded to the On.eus portal, a website that offers tools to live in Basque in the French Basque Country and was published in September to help with this task. The members who have received the recognition have said that the award is to be welcomed because the Basque and Basque world is "quite precarious". "It is true that it is not always easy to work in the community, and it is to be welcomed that the work we do is recognized here," they add, "because it is obvious that the Basque is not in a good situation."
On the other hand, Jakoba Errekondo has received the milestone of honor for her work The Garden of Life, which has received thanks and has proclaimed that the garden lives and will live: "We want to revolutionize today's world to reap the harvest of love."
The other finalists of the journalism award have been Goiena, for her essay Datetatik tiriraka; the producer Baleuko, for Ur handitan; Palestine, for her endless conflict; and Nagore Arin, for her documentary and chronicle about the BasqueFestival Berria n Boise.
The Communications Awards are: Elhuyar for the Whirlwind Project; Ulu Media for the HOWL digital media; and GUKA for the Castellanomanchor Machine campaign;
